Tips for Parents and Caregivers
- Recognize that your children’s mental health is just as important as their physical health.
- Spend time with your children daily listening to them and talking to them about what is happening in their lives.
- Provide unconditional love and support to your children.
- Educate yourself about children’s mental health and illness.
- Talk about emotions and feelings with your child.
- Teach and model tolerance and understanding about mental illness.
- If you’re concerned about your child’s mental health, consult with their teachers, guidance counselor, or other adults that may have information about your child’s behavior.
- If you think there might be a problem, seek professional help.
- If treatment is needed, a comprehensive plan should be developed including the child.
